In recent weeks, China has witnessed unprecedented demand for the Tesla Model Y, sparking massive queues at showrooms across the nation. What began as a surge in interest has evolved into a full-blown race among buyers, distributors, and Tesla’s own dealership network, driven by relentless demand and limited supply. This phenomenon underscores Tesla’s growing influence in one of the world’s largest automotive markets—and the intense competition reshaping the EV race in China.

Chinese cities like Shanghai, Beijing, and Chengdu now regularly report long lines stretching hundreds of meters outside Tesla showrooms. Drivers—influenced by personal experiences, social media buzz, and aggressive pre-order campaigns—are clamoring to secure a Model Y before production catches up. This demand surge, fueled by China’s push toward green mobility and EV adoption, has placed enormous pressure on Tesla’s manufacturing and delivery timelines.
Seeing unprecedented buyer interest, Tesla’s China team has ramped up showroom output and plugged hiring for sales representatives, technicians, and logistics staff. Yet supply chain bottlenecks and local demand outpacing initial forecasts mean queues remain stubbornly long despite recent capacity hikes.
Why Is Tesla Model Y So Desired in China?
Several key factors explain the Model Y’s meteoric rise in the Chinese market:

Premium EV Experience: The Model Y combines Tesla’s cutting-edge autonomous features with spacious interior design, appealing to tech-savvy urban buyers.
-
Strong Local Presence: Tesla’s Shanghai Gigafactory ensures relatively fast delivery times compared to imports, making it a practical choice amid long EV delivery waits.
-
Government Incentives & Environmental Push: With China’s aggressive carbon neutrality goals and generous EV subsidies, the Model Y sits well within both policy and consumer priorities.
-
Brand Loyalty & Innovation: Tesla’s reputation for innovation—from Full Self-Driving capabilities to over-the-air software updates—keeps customers coming back.

This surge highlights how China has become the epicenter of global EV competition. Massive demand for the Model Y is not just a sign of Tesla’s success but also a wake-up call for local and international automakers racing to catch up. Companies are reevaluating production strategies, expanding local supply chains, and doubling down on EV development to keep pace.
For Tesla’s future in China, overcoming these lines means balancing marketing momentum with scalable delivery—critical as Beijing tightens regulations and pushes for homegrown EV champions.
What’s Next?
Industry analysts predict steady model updates and expanded capacity as Tesla prepares for the next wave of demand. Meanwhile, rival Chinese EV manufacturers are uprating their offerings, striving to capture market share amid shifting terrain.
